Liverpool lose Agger and Alonso
Liverpool's Daniel Agger and Xabi Alonso could be out for up to six weeks after both suffered broken metatarsals.
Denmark international Agger had been playing with the injury but complained of soreness ahead of Tuesday's Champions League draw in Porto.
Spain midfielder Alonso suffered the injury in Saturday's draw at Portsmouth and limped out of training on Monday.
"Neither player requires surgery but we expect them to be out for between four and six weeks," said a spokesman.
Liverpool manager Rafael Benitez has already made 38 changes in their nine matches this season.

The absence of Agger could expose a weakness in Benitez's squad at the heart of the defence.
But Liverpool are boosted by the return to fitness of defenders Fabio Aurelio and John Arne Riise.
